Thiruvananthapuram
THIRUVANANTHAPURAM: Chief Minister V.S. Achuthanandan will launch the ‘Nammude Maram’ (Our Tree) campaign for Plus Two and college students on the Kariyavattom University campus on June 5, the World Environment Day. Forest Minister Benoy Viswom and Education Minister M.A. Baby told reporters here on Friday that social forestry programme being launched by the Forest and Education Departments as a follow-up to the ‘Ente Maram’ campaign initiated in schools all over the State last year, would cover all government, aided and self-financing colleges, technical educational institutions, VHSE and higher secondary schools. The Ministers addressed a meeting of student leaders, university union office-bearers and officials on Friday to work out the details of the drive. As a prelude to the drive, teachers, students and officials of Forest and Agriculture Departments would conduct a survey to study the texture of soil and identify the saplings that could be planted in each locale. 10 lakh saplingsNo foreign species like acacia will be planted as part of the drive. It has been proposed to plant 10 lakh saplings this year. Multi-level coordination committees headed by Vice-Chancellors and principals would be formed for monitoring the campaign. Literary competitions and seminars would be held as part of the campaign. Awards would be given for the university and college for outstanding performance, they said.
